Registering Group Addresses in Coded Dial Codes The Group Address feature enables you to create a group of up to 199 stored destinations as a single destination. The destinations must be registered in the coded dial codes beforehand. 1 Press [Menu]. 2 Press or to select , then press [OK]. MENU 5.ADDRESS BOOK SET. If a password has been set for the Address Book, enter the password using - [numeric keys], then press [OK]. 3 Press or to select , then press [OK]. ADDRESS BOOK SET. 3.GROUP DIAL 5-16
